Adobe Connect description

Adobe Connect is a cloud-based platform designed for businesses to run online meetings, webinars, and training sessions. It allows you to create a virtual space where you can share presentations, videos, and other content with attendees. Adobe Connect offers tools for engagement and interaction, like polls and Q&A, and provides analytics to track participation. It focuses on delivering a high-quality virtual experience with features like customizable branding and global reach. While it offers a robust set of features, it is best suited for mid-size to large companies.


Who is Adobe Connect best for

Adobe Connect is ideal for businesses and institutions needing interactive online training, webinars, and virtual classrooms. Users praise its customizable rooms and integrations with other Adobe products, especially for robust features like polls, Q&A, and breakout rooms. However, some find it complex and expensive, with occasional performance issues.

  • Best for medium to large businesses seeking a robust virtual meeting and webinar solution.

  • Suitable for various industries, particularly effective in Healthcare, Finance, Retail, Education, and more.

Adobe Connect reviews

We've summarised 1639 Adobe Connect reviews (Adobe Connect GetApp reviews, Adobe Connect Software Advice reviews, Adobe Connect Capterra reviews and Adobe Connect G2 reviews) and summarised the main points below.

Pros of Adobe Connect
  • Highly customizable virtual rooms with various layouts and pods.
  • Seamless integration with other Adobe products.
  • Robust features for webinars and online training, including polls, Q&A, and breakout rooms.
  • High-quality video and audio when connection is stable.
  • Ability to record sessions and share them later.
Cons of Adobe Connect
  • Difficult to use for those unfamiliar with Adobe products.
  • The mobile app has limited functionality compared to the desktop version.
  • Audio issues, especially echo and voice lag.
  • High cost compared to competitors, especially for limited usage.
  • Occasional glitches and crashes, especially with large groups or unstable internet connections.

Adobe Connect pricing

The commentary is based on 88 reviews from Adobe Connect Capterra reviews, Adobe Connect G2 reviews and Adobe Connect Software Advice reviews.

Adobe Connect is a powerful web conferencing solution with robust features, praised for its customization options and interactive tools. However, reviews frequently mention the high cost and complex pricing structure as significant drawbacks, particularly for smaller businesses or individuals. Some users find the platform expensive compared to alternatives with similar functionalities.
